About Sumin Choi

Sumin Choi is a scholar working on Electronic, Optical and Magnetic Materials, Atomic and Molecular Physics, and Optics and Materials Chemistry, having authored 25 papers that have together received 769 indexed citations. Recurring topics across this work include ZnO doping and properties (8 papers), Semiconductor Quantum Structures and Devices (5 papers) and Ga2O3 and related materials (5 papers). The work is most often cited by research in Electronic, Optical and Magnetic Materials (409 citations), Acoustics and Ultrasonics (15 citations) and Aerospace Engineering (205 citations). Sumin Choi has collaborated with scholars based in Australia, South Korea and Japan. Frequent co-authors include Igor Aharonovich, Leonid A. Krivitsky, Victor Leong, Xinan Liang, Yefeng Yu, Yuan Hsing Fu, Ramón Paniagua‐Domínguez, Vytautas Valuckas, Arseniy I. Kuznetsov and Egor Khaidarov. Their work appears in journals such as Nano Letters, Applied Physics Letters and Scientific Reports.
